Joe E. Deitz Obituary

It is with deep sorrow that we announce the death of Joe E. Deitz (Decatur, Illinois), born in Bible Grove, Illinois, who passed away on March 4, 2020, at the age of 87, leaving to mourn family and friends. You can send your sympathy in the guestbook provided and share it with the family.

He was predeceased by: his parents, Arthur Deitz and May Deitz; his wife Nina Mae Harmon; his brother Charles; and his daughter Judy McCrate.

He is survived by: his daughter Janet Sporleder (Brent) of Fisher, Illinois; and his close friend Sharon Hawthorne. He is also survived by three grandchildren; six great-grandchildren; one great-great-granddaughter; many nieces and nephews.

In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to Janet Sporleder to be dispensed to local charities.
